About us:

Whitehaven Flower arrangement Society was established over 45 years ago, and recently celebrated it’s Sapphire anniversary.  We have over 80 members who meet once a month, and anyone with a love of flowers (or a desire to know more) is welcome. It is important to know that you do not need to be a flower arranger to attend.  Some members / visitors attend to watch the demonstrations and meet new friends.

We are known to be a friendly club with members of all ages, ensuring our guests and new members receive the warm welcome and genuine hospitality that West Cumbria is famous for.

In keeping with the spirit of NAFAS, The Whitehaven Flower Club supports our local community by participating in many annual events where flowers and our member’s creative talents can be enjoyed. Our club usually stages at least one or two Flower festivals for local churches each year.

More recently some of our members have had success at shows (local and National level) including Chelsea Flower Show and Carlisle show at Bitts Park. 

Joan Mossop designs the flowers for the classical concerts at the Rosehill Theatre. In addition, Janice Timmington provides the hospital service at The West Cumberland hospital during  the year. This includes flowers throughout the year, the remembrance service for baby deaths, and a Christmas tree in both the hospital foyer and chapel.

Many local weddings have been adorned by our member’s beautiful handiwork over the years.  We usually meet at St St Beghs Social Club, Coach Rd, Whitehaven between 2pm – 4pm on the second Friday of each month in Jan, Mar, April, May, Aug, Sept and October. There is also an opportunity to attend two spectacular gala night demonstrations at The Rosehill Theatre locally (June and November) and a club outing (usually July or Aug) which is generally a trip to a flower show or special garden. Many members attend for a happy Christmas lunch in December. These event charged extra at nominal cost.  Please see the events calendar for what is on in 2009 / 2010.

We regualarly attend the fun workshops organsied by the Area which are a varied mix of new techniques and floral or craft skills which enhances our love of flowers.

Subscription : £10.00 per year (which includes up to 7 demonstrations or talks at St Beghs). Non-members are very welcome to attend and will pay £2.00 on the door each visit. The beautiful fresh arrangements are raffled at the end of each meeting. A Sales Table is available at each meeting for reasonably priced flower arranging accessories.
